Artist Bio – Paul Henri Martel
Paul Martel
Paul Martel (b.1966), of St. Isidore, Alberta, is a down-to-earth, self-taught painter. He made his appearance on the Peace Country arts scene in 2004, and has been embraced by regional painting aficionados ever since. His works are easily recognizable, usually featuring electrifying skyscapes, in dramatic colours, with explosive lines. Paul has a very striking, distinctive style, and the ranks of his collectors continue to swell.
Paul's artwork is heavily influenced by the rural landscapes of the Peace Country. This transplanted Edmontonian has lived in St. Isidore and worked as a teacher in Peace River for 17 years.
